WebIn order to produce a digital signal, an analogue signal must first be sampled by a periodic pulse train to convert it from continuous to discrete time. If a continuous signal has a bandwidth W, then the minimum sampling frequency, fs, that can be used is f s = 2W. This is called the Nyquist rate.

A … WebTo start, we define the continuous time impulse train as: As you just saw, p ( t) is an infinite train of continuous time impulse functions, spaced Ts seconds apart. Now, x ( t) is the continuous time signal we wish to sample. We will model sampling as multiplying a signal by p ( t ). Let xs ( t) = x ( t) p ( t ) be the sampled signal. Then shop footwear online
